Much higher BPA amounts linked to worse breathing problem in youngsters.NIEHS beneficiaries found that kids, especially children, along with elevated degrees of bisphenol A (BPA) in their pee had a lot more asthma symptoms. The research is actually the very first to review kids's direct exposure to BPA and also its common substitutes bisphenol S (BPS) and also bisphenol F (BPF), relative to bronchial asthma severity. BPA, made use of to create polycarbonate plastics as well as epoxy resins, might be present in oral sealers, the cellular lining of meals as well as alcoholic beverage containers, playthings, plastic tableware, and other individual products. Lots of people are actually revealed through their diet.The research study featured 148 children along with asthma coming from low-income neighborhoods aged 5 to 17 years. Participants, the majority of whom were African-american, were part of the Computer mouse Irritant and also Bronchial Asthma Friend Study, administered between 2007 as well as 2009 in Baltimore. The researchers analyzed held urine samples as well as data coming from clinical check outs, including breathing problem indicators, medical visits, lung function, and inflammation.A 10-fold rise in urinary BPA amounts was actually related to a 40% increase in the chance of youngsters experiencing coughing, wheezing, or chest tightness. Likewise, for each 10-fold increase in urinary BPA, the possibilities of asthma-related acute care or even emergency-room sees raised by 84% and also 112%, respectively. Each improved bronchial asthma indicators as well as medical care visits were actually statistically notable merely for young boys. Higher BPS or BPF degrees were actually not consistently related to more bronchial asthma indicators or even healthcare visits.Given prevalent direct exposure to BPA and superior frequency of little one breathing problem in the U.S., the scientists required added researches to validate their seekings. If confirmed, kids with breathing problem may take advantage of reduced exposure to BPA, mention the researchers.Citation: Quiros-Alcala L, Hansel NN, McCormack M, Calafat AM, Ye X, Peng RD, Matsui EC. 2020. Dragonflies give insight in to mercury contamination, resident scientific research research study discovers.A brand new NIEHS-funded study located that immature dragonfly larvae could be used to determine the volume of mercury found in neighborhood fish, frogs, and also birds. The study utilized information from a national-scale citizen scientific research project that began more than a decade ago.Researchers put together information on mercury degrees in hundreds of larval dragonflies picked up coming from 457 locations across 100 U.S. National Park Solution internet sites between 2009 and also 2018. They also reviewed factors, such as environment style, that may represent variety in dragonfly mercury attentions, which were actually nearly pair of times higher in habitats along with circulating water, like rivers and also streams, compared with still water internet sites like ponds as well as fish ponds. The researchers advised that dragonfly larvae can be used to examine mercury in marine food webs, given that fish and also frogs coming from the very same places showed comparable amounts. These lookings for were utilized to establish an index of mercury danger to marine communities. The group determined that 56% of the park web sites were classified as mild threats and 12% showed high or intense risks to fish, wildlife, or even individual health and wellness. Source managers can utilize this method to better determine the threat mercury might posture to ecosystems.Collectively, this study demonstrated that dragonfly larvae deliver an easy and also economical device for predicting mercury exposure in fish and also wildlife. It also supplies a prosperous structure for engaging consumer experts.Citation: Eagles-Smith CA, Willacker JJ, Nelson SJ, Flanagan Pritz Centimeters, Krabbenhoft DP, Chen CY, Ackerman JT, Campbell Give EH, Pilliod DS. 2020. Chair microbiome opens developments in diagnosing liver ailment.NIEHS grantees and partners established a swift, affordable device to precisely diagnose liver fibrosis as well as cirrhosis. The noninvasive strategy utilizes chair samples to characterize the digestive tract microbiome, or the micro-organisms that stay in digestive tract, which has actually been connected to liver wellness. The approach could possibly result in enhanced client care and also treatment end results for liver disease.Fibrosis, or even the buildup of mark tissue in the liver, can be reversed if identified early. Long-term, repeated scarring can trigger cirrhosis and also irreversible liver damage. Scientist researched feces examples from 163 clients with liver ailment as well as their healthy and balanced member of the family. Making use of metabolic and also hereditary profiling and also artificial intelligence, they created a digestive tract microbiome signature for liver condition based upon differences in the types and also quantities of germs in patients compared to well-balanced people. A microbiome trademark based upon 19 bacterial types present just in the person group effectively identified cirrhosis in 94% of patients. To even further confirm the trademark, they used it to cirrhosis patient populations in China and Italy and also the right way recognized the health condition in much more than 90% of scenarios. Additionally, the signature distinguished early stage fibrosis coming from cirrhosis.This common intestine microbiome trademark can easily recognize cirrhosis around geographically divided pals, individual of the impacts of genetics as well as setting. According to the writers, the method has enormous potential to strengthen liver disease prognosis, particularly in resource-limited environments where other screening possibilities might certainly not be available.Citation: Oh TG, Kim SM, Caussy C, Fu T, Guo J, Bassirian S, Singh S, Madamba EV, Bettencourt R, Richards L, Raffatellu M, Dorrestein Computer, Yu RT, Atkins AR, Huan T, Brenner DA, Sirlin CB, Knight R, Downes M, Evans RM, Loomba R. 2020. Contaminated air fragments increase irritation in aged men.Senior guys left open to contaminated air pollution bits had actually raised amounts of inflammatory biomarkers linked to heart problem, according to an NIEHS-funded research study. The findings suggest irritation as the path whereby contaminated particle concern may increase heart disease risk.Radon, a naturally-occurring gasoline, malfunction in to radioactive fragments that affix to particle air pollution and also can discharge radiation in the bronchis if inhaled. The research study included 752 guys in the greater Boston ma place aged 75 years usually. The analysts used regular sizes coming from 5 radiation monitors in the research study location to compute short- as well as medium-term average exposures to bit radioactivity. Using analytical styles, they found favorable associations between fragment radioactivity and biomarkers of each inflammation and also vascular problems. They apart results of radioactivity from various other toxins by utilizing styles along with as well as without change for great particle matter, black carbon, and also various other materials. Male along with increased visibility to temporary particle radioactivity possessed much higher degrees of the inflamed biomarker C-reactive healthy protein. General disorder biomarkers were likewise enhanced along with greater temporary visibility. The effects of exposure to radioactive fragments continued to be after correction for air pollutants, for the most part.Citation: Blomberg AJ, Nyhan MM, Tie MA, Vokonas P, Coull BA, Schwartz J, Koutrakis P. 2020.
